Holy Land battle: Solomon's Pools become flashpoint in fight over Israel's biblical heritage
Solomon's Pools, ancient water reservoirs near Efrat and Bethlehem, are at the center of a dispute between Israeli officials and the Palestinian Authority over jurisdiction and preservation. The site, under Palestinian civil and security control in Area A since the 1993 Oslo Accords, is accused of neglect and sewage contamination by Efrat's mayor and municipality, who argue it should remain under Israeli control to protect its historical and touristic value.
